Just an update...I'm about 80% done cleaning/detailing the engine bay. Still some to do...
I still havent had it power washed/steam cleaned yet.. All I did was use rags , paintbrush and 2 cans of WD40,
scrubbed around the engine bay alot of parts taken off and cleaned..
Power washing/steaming will do the trick..
I'm gonna someone locally help with the powerwashing etc etc.

Anyways heres some pics of the progress...

before:
http://i34.tinypic.com/2ihma93.jpg


80% done after:
http://i38.tinypic.com/f2ombp.jpg

http://i35.tinypic.com/2rge6g1.jpg


The car was oil sprayed when bought brand new...
Its been sitting in a workshop, covered under a car cover.
Alot of dust went inside the engine bay and embedded onto the oilspray/rustproofing...
Engine bay has never been washed in 19 years..
Alot of the parts/bolts are still new, shiney because of it...
I did have to change the engine mount (got for free) and a couple 12mm nuts though.
